Abstract
Eradicating poverty is a fundamental objective of social work, both at local and at global levels.
After COVID-19, the United Nations Commission for Social Development and Sustainable
Development Goals, the global agenda developed by the International Association of Schools
of Social Work, the International Council on Social Welfare and the International Federation of
Social Workers have placed the fight against poverty and the role of decent work at the forefront
of the public agenda. We analyse most recent publications on decent work, highlighting two
strategies to promote poverty eradication from social work: participation and education.
